Virginia Tech says it's unaffiliated with speaker fired by Columbia for anti-Israel statements
Virginia Tech officials said a talk scheduled for Friday evening featuring a former Columbia University professor fired over anti-Israel statements is not affiliated with the university.
Fired Columbia professor who backed Hamas set to speak at Virginia Tech 'Death to the Akademy' event
Former Columbia University professor Mohamed Abdou, fired after declaring support for Hamas and Hezbollah, is scheduled to speak Friday at an event set to be held at Virginia Tech.
